The handsome guy on the cover of this book is not
Pete Williams but Mark Verstegen, owner of the
Athletes’ Performance training center in Tempe, Arizona,
and the trainer of some of the top champions in sports. In this book, Williams
teamed up with Verstegen to show readers how they can apply the same training
methods Verstegen uses with his pro athletes to achieve a lean, powerful, flexible
physique that’s resistant to injury and long-term deterioration.
Core Performance: The Revolutionary Workout Program to Transform Your
Body and Your Life is the first workout program that delivers strength
and muscle mass, balance and flexibility, athletic quickness, power and
a lean body – all in less than an hour a day. A detailed nutrition
section shows readers how to feed muscles, starve fat and produce boundless
energy when they need it most.
Since the book’s publication in early 2004, Verstegen’s “Core” system
and his revolutionary nutrition program have been adapted by many trainers
and fitness centers. Unlike those who use “core” and “abs” synonymously,
Verstegen shows how the core region (shoulders, midsection, and hips) is
the key to optimum human performance and health. Check out the book that
started a fitness revolution, now available in paperback.
